| Overview |
A privacy-first analytics platform built around straightforward traffic reporting, lightweight event tracking, and GDPR-friendly measurement with minimal setup. | An open-source, self-hosted or managed-cloud analytics platform with cookieless traffic and event reporting plus newer funnels, revenue, Web Vitals, session replay, and heatmap capabilities. |
| Pricing |
Free hobby plan with one month of history; paid self-serve pricing starts at €20/month for 100K monthly pageviews; Enterprise is custom | Self-hosted open source; Umami Cloud plans are Hobby $0, Pro $20/month, Business $200/month, Enterprise custom |
| Deployment |
Vendor-hosted cloud | Self-hosted and hosted options |

| Important considerations |
Free accounts retain only one month of history and require a public badge; paid price varies with data-point volume and extra users. | Cloud usage counts page hits, custom events, and stored event properties; self-hosting shifts upgrades, database operation, and backups to your team. |
